[QUOTE="jimmy_goodfella, post: 14298, member: 919"]north west territory mint sells its silver in bar form at spot + 60 cents ounce. thats probably as cheap as you get.you have to by a small quantity as a minimum to get this. silver eagles go for a premium of about 2 usd each if bought by the tube, can get these also at same place or most anywhere. canadian maples got for spot+ 1.50 coin.once again by the tups. rounds/medallions can usually be bought at about spot + 1 usd each. these prices are about as cheap as you will get,check out a lot of places and there reputations before making any purchase and once happy try them out with min quantity and build up your purchases. another popular way to acumulate silver is in old so called junk coins.These can often be had for little more than spot price but dont expect to find any good uns amougst them.They can often be purchased from as little as 4.5x face.this it depends again how much you want to buy a 1000 usd face bag or pay a bit more premium for parts of. most people that buy silver for investment i know buy a mixture of all of the above.[/QUOTE]
